BODY {margin:0px;padding:0px;font-size:80%;color: #343434;}FORM { margin:0px; }TR,TH,TD{text-align: left;line-height:140%;}P{margin:0px;}H1 {display:inline;margin:0px 0px 0px 10px;font-size:10px;color:#676767;line-height:110%;font-weight: normal;text-align:left;}.search { width:120px; height:14px; margin-right:5px; font-size:12px;line-height:120%;padding:0px;}A:link{text-decoration:none;color:#343434;} A:visited{text-decoration:none;color:#343434;} A:active{text-decoration:underline;color:#009380;} A:hover{text-decoration:underline;color:#009380;}A.viccol:link{text-decoration:none;color:#009380;} A.viccol:visited{text-decoration:none;color:#009380;} A.viccol:active{text-decoration:underline;color:#00C9AF;} A.viccol:hover{text-decoration:underline;color:#00C9AF;} A.service:link{text-decoration:underline;color:#CC3300;} A.service:visited{text-decoration:underline;color:#CC3300;} A.service:active{text-decoration:underline;color:#FF6633;} A.service:hover{text-decoration:underline;color:#FF6633;} #page {margin-right: auto;margin-left: auto;padding: 0px;width: 780px;border: 1px solid #555555;}.topin10{margin-top:10px;margin-left:3px;}.spText{font-size:11px;color:#666666;padding-top:5px;}.footmenu{text-align:center;font-size:11px;margin-top:10px;margin-bottom:10px;}.font11{font-size:11px;}.listmenu{text-align:left;font-size:11px;margin-left:10px;margin-top:3px;}.graphTitle{text-align:center;color:#FFFFFF;margin-top:2px;margin-bottom:2px;}.font10{font-size:10px;_font-size:11px;}.sleftin5{font-size:10px;_font-size:11px;margin-left:5px;}.newsDate{color:#009380;}.newsYear{background-color:#EDEDED;width: 550px;height:19px;padding-left:5px;padding-top:3px;font-size:12px;}#newsTitle{width: 550px;text-align:center;font-size:16px;font-weight:bold;color:#30678D;line-height:140%;padding-top:10px;padding-bottom:10px;}#newsSub{width: 550px;text-align:center;font-size:12px;padding-top:0px;padding-bottom:10px;}#newsTitleDate{font-size:12px;border-bottom:1px solid #999999;}.tableText{padding:4px 0px 4px 5px;}.faqText{padding:0px 0px 0px 5px;}.spCaption{font-size:10px;_font-size:11px;color:#666666;}.spName{font-size:14px;font-weight:bold;margin-top:5px;padding-bottom:5px;}.spNameSmall{font-size:12px;font-weight:bold;margin-top:5px;padding-bottom:5px;}.paraText{padding-top:5px;padding-bottom:5px;}.groupName{margin-bottom:5px;}.topNews{font-size:11px;margin-top:5px;margin-bottom:3px;margin-left:10px;}.kensaku{font-size:10px;_font-size:11px;margin-top:10px;margin-bottom:10px;padding-left:10px;padding-bottom:3px;color:#666666;border:0px;}.smallGray{font-size:10px;_font-size:11px;color:#666666;}.smallpercent{font-size:80%;}.startCnt{margin-top:10px;}.more{font-size:11px;line-height:140%;}.askmail{font-size:11px;line-height:140%;}.leftin10{margin-left:10px;}.leftin20{margin-left:20px;}.leftin5{margin-left:5px;}.para10{margin-top:10px;margin-left:10px;}.stepText{margin-top:10px;margin-left:10px;margin-bottom:10px;}.conceptText{line-height:200%;}.worksText{font-size:80%;margin-left:20px;}.worksTextEnd{font-size:80%;margin-left:20px;margin-bottom:10px;}.worksTextIn{font-size:80%;margin-left:30px;margin-bottom:10px;}.paraIn20{margin-left:20px;margin-bottom:5px;}.nameIn{margin-left:30px;}.topiDate{text-align:right;margin-left:10px;margin-top:5px;padding:3px;border-bottom:3px solid #CCCCCC;font-size:10px;_font-size:10px;}.koen1{text-align:left;padding:3px;background-color:#EAF9D4;color:#709437;}.koen2{text-align:left;padding:3px;background-color:#FFF0F7;color:#C75C8E;}.koen3{text-align:left;padding:3px;background-color:#FBFAE5;color:#BB9224;}.koenDate{text-align:right;margin-top:5px;font-size:10px;_font-size:11px;}.koushi1{margin-top:10px;margin-left:10px;padding-left:5px;border-left:2px solid #709437;}.koushi2{margin-top:10px;margin-left:10px;padding-left:5px;border-left:2px solid #C75C8E;}.koushi3{margin-top:10px;margin-left:10px;padding-left:5px;border-left:2px solid #BB9224;}.blueline{background-color:#BDE1F7;padding:5px;border:1px solid #377BA5;}.pinkline{background-color:#F6BBC2;padding:5px;border:1px solid #F1707F;}.greenline{background-color:#C4DE98;padding:5px;border:1px solid #92C935;}
